For the 2026 school year, there are 3 public middle schools serving 1,643 students in Mandeville, LA. The top-ranked public middle schools in Mandeville, LA are Mandeville Junior High School, L.p. Monteleone Junior High School and Fontainebleau Junior High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Mandeville, LA public middle schools have an average math proficiency score of 54% (versus the Louisiana public middle school average of 31%), and reading proficiency score of 63% (versus the 42% statewide average). Middle schools in Mandeville have an average ranking of 10/10, which is in the top 10% of Louisiana public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 27%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Black), which is less than the Louisiana public middle school average of 60% (majority Black).
